#beec54 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#beec54 is composed of 74.5% red, 92.5%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 64.4%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 78.2 degrees, a saturation of 80% and a lightness of 62.7%. #beec54 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a8 with #7dd900. Closest websafe color is: #ccff66.

#beec54 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#beec54 has RGB values of R:190, G:236,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0.19, M:0, Y:0.64,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 12512340.

Shades and Tints of #beec54

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040601 is the darkest color, while #fafef3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#beec54

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a1a39d is the less saturated color, while #c4fb45 is the most saturated one.
